Course Introduction

Formulating business needs, defining and planning projects, selecting providers, negotiating contracts, and managing project delivery all require a detailed understanding of commercial processes and strong management skills to minimise risk and maximise organisational value. Poorly managed contracts can be time-consuming, disruptive, and extremely costly.

This highly intensive Advanced Strategic Contract Management training course equips participants with the advanced capabilities needed to manage contracts effectively in an increasingly complex and fast-changing business environment. It provides a systematic, proven approach to the full contract lifecycle- from planning and procurement to negotiation, delivery, risk management, and closure- enabling the effective and efficient achievement of business objectives.

Designed for professionals with experience in project or contract management, this course builds on existing knowledge in a clear and practical way. Participants will gain advanced tools, techniques, and insights that can be applied immediately to enhance commercial performance, mitigate risk, and maximise the value returned from critical project contracts.
